S-Glass Fiber high strength
High strength glass fibers made from the magnesium alumino silicate glass system meeting the needs of military application have been developed and put into volume production since 70’ s & 90’ s last century respectively.
Compared with E Glass fiber, they exhibit 30-40% higher tensile strength,16-20% higher modulus of elasticity.10 folds higher fatigue resistance,100-150 degree higher temperature endure, also they have excellent impact resistance because of high elongation to break, high ageing & corrosion resistance, quick resin wet-out properties.

Feature
●Good tensile strength.
●High modulus of elasticity
●100 to 150 degrees celsius better temperature endurance
●10 fold higher fatigue resistance
●Excellent impact resistance because of the high elongation to breakage
●High ageing and corrosion resistance
●Quick resin wet-out properties
●Weight saving at the same performance

Application
Aerospace, marine and arms industries due to its high tensile strength and higher modulus of elasticity when compared to e-glass.
